An earthquake measuring 5.0 magnitude on the Richter scale hit on Tuesday Cordoba province in Argentina.The US Geological Survey (USGS) said in a statement that the earthquake occurred 51 km from Salsacate town, at a depth of 145.2 km.There have been no reports of casualties or material damage as a result of the earthquake.On Sep. 22, an earthquake measuring 6.0 magnitude on the Richter scale struck San Luis province in western Argentina. No casualties or material losses were reportedSource: Qatar News Agency
